Ballot Text

Technical Summary

 This document establishes definitions and
 describes measurement techniques for data center benchmarking, as
well as introduces new terminologies applicable to data center
performance evaluations. 

Working Group Summary
  
  Note to IESG: draft-ietf-bmwg-dcbench-terminology and draft-ietf-bmwg-dcbench-methodology are closely related.
  There has been an extensive amount of work done on these drafts, and progress made on revisions, feedback, and comments. There have been extensive conversations on, for example, "goodput". This are some of the most reviewed drafts in BMWG in quite some time, and the documents  have undergone 2 WGLCs.
